Can Marijuana Cause Lung Cancer?

Can Marijuana Cause Lung Cancer

Marijuana smoke contains carcinogens similar to tobacco. While a direct link to lung cancer isn’t confirmed, heavy or long-term use—especially with tobacco—may increase cancer and lung disease risks.

Lorazepam vs Xanax: Key Differences Explained

Lorazepam vs Xanax: Key Differences Explained

Ativan (lorazepam) and Xanax (alprazolam) both treat anxiety but differ in onset, duration, and side effects. Xanax acts faster for panic, while Ativan lasts longer for ongoing relief. Both carry addiction risks and require medical guidance.
